Why These Are the Top Home Security Contractors in Kurten

** The home security market for Kurten, Texas, is intrinsically linked to the larger Bryan-College Station area. As a rural community, residents rely on providers from this metropolitan hub for service. The market is moderately competitive, featuring a mix of national giants (ADT, Vivint) and strong regional players (like Brazos Valley Alarm). The average quality is high, as companies must be equipped to service both standard suburban homes and larger rural properties, which may require more robust equipment like cellular backups and long-range cameras. Typical pricing is consistent with national averages. Basic monitored alarm systems start around **$30-$45 per month**, plus an initial equipment and installation cost that can range from **$0 to $1,500+**, depending on promotions and system complexity. For comprehensive systems with smart home integration, video doorbells, and multiple security cameras, monthly fees can reach **$60-$100+**. Local companies often provide more flexible, non-contract options, while national providers typically require 36-month contracts but offer more extensive equipment financing plans. The key differentiators in this market are the reliability of cellular monitoring (critical in rural areas), the quality of smart home integration, and the responsiveness of local customer service and technical support.

2How does Kurten's rural setting and Texas climate impact my security system choice?

Kurten's semi-rural landscape means reliable cellular or internet-based systems are essential, as traditional phone lines can be less secure. The intense Texas heat, humidity, and potential for severe storms require systems with durable, weather-resistant outdoor cameras and components. Ensure your provider offers battery and cellular backup to maintain protection during frequent Central Texas power fluctuations or internet outages.

3Are there any local regulations in Kurten or Texas I should know about for installing security cameras?

Texas law allows you to install security cameras on your property, but you cannot record audio without consent (one-party consent law) and must avoid pointing cameras directly into a neighbor's private windows. In Kurten's more spacious properties, this is less common, but always respect privacy boundaries. There are no specific local Kurten ordinances, but following Texas state law and checking your property's HOA rules, if applicable, is crucial.
